Cycled QT tank currently has copper at therapeutic levels. Do people perform water changes during the 30 days or just monitor nitrates to a certain level?
You want to run your copper treatment for a full 30 days and monitor the ammonia levels during this time with a reliable test kit. If you run as an example, , , your copper level at 2.25 - if you must do a water change, mix and add copper back at 2.25 to maintain level. A copper test kit will help determine your needs and level

Thanks. What am I testing to determine if a water change is needed during the 30 days?
Just monitor Ammonia, those seachem ammonia alert badges work wonders! Just keep the tank clean and don’t let food settle and go to waste
